A massive wind turbine — capable of turning the breeze into two million watts of power — has 40 - meter - long blades made from fiberglass, towers 90 meters above the ground, weighs hundreds of metric tons, and fundamentally relies on roughly 300 kilograms of a soft, silvery metal known as neodymium — a so - called rare earth.

Unlike horizontal axis wind turbines (HAWTs), which maintain a steady torque if the wind remains steady, VAWTs have two «pulses» of torque and power for each blade, based on whether the blade is in the upwind or downwind position.

LM Wind Power's wind turbine blades made from a unique blend of carbon and glass fiber and other materials are the lightest in the world.
LM Wind Power builds rotor blades for the industry's bread - and - butter 1.5 - and 2 - megawatt wind turbines, as well as 8 - megawatt behemoths with rotors spanning 180 meters, or roughly the length of two football fields.
About one in five of the world's turbines use LM Wind Power blades.
